In both EB2 and EB3 visas, the processing time form I-140 takes is approximately 6-9 months. You can get it done in 15 days if you pay premium processing. You receive a priority date when your I-140 form is filed. What is typically done is filing the I-140 under the category that offers a more advantageous date. For instance, if you are in the EB-2 category and the EB-2 date is more favorable, you would file under EB-2. Conversely, if EB-3 is more beneficial, you would choose that option. F. RETROGRESSION IN THE EMPLOYMENT-BASED FIRST PREFERENCE (EB-1) FOR INDIA. As readers were informed was possible in the May 2023 Visa Bulletin, it has become necessary to retrogress the EB-1 final action date for India, effective in August. For both EB-2 and EB-3, PERM labor certification is required, whose processing time takes about six-twelve months. For FB and EB green card categories, the Visa Bulletin posts two charts each month: one for “Dates for Filing” and ...Yes, you can hold two approved I-140s. Those filing for an EB3 downgrade by submitting a new or a second I-140 will retain an EB2 I-140, and hold the EB3 I-140 once it is approved. Now, a priority date can only be lost under two circumstances which are: If the employer's I-140 is revoked by the USCIS because of fraud. If you are in the United States, After I-140 is approved, when the priority date is current, you can apply for green card I-485, and you can apply for reentry permit I-131 and work card I-765 at the same time.

The fiscal year 2021 limit for employment-based preference immigrants calculated under INA 201 is 262,288. Section 202 prescribes that the per-country limit for preference immigrants is set at 7% of the total annual family-sponsored and employment-based preference limits, i.e., 34,180 for FY-2021. India EB-3 Retrogression. This notice serves to clarify the retrogression that will take place for Employment-Based Third preference (EB-3) visa applicants chargeable to India, effective in the July 2023 Visa Bulletin .
